比特币钱包地址的种类与变化解析

## 一、引言 比特币作为一种去中心化的数字货币,自问世以来便引起了广泛的关注和讨论。在比特币的生态系统中,钱包地址是交易和存储比特币的关键要素。理解比特币钱包地址的种类及其变化,将帮助用户更好地管理和保护他们的资产。 ## 二、比特币钱包地址的基本概念 ### 1. 什么是比特币钱包地址? 比特币钱包地址是使用公钥加密生成的一个字符串,类似于银行的账号。用户通过这个地址可以接收和发送比特币。在进行交易时,发送方需要输入接收方的比特币地址。每个地址都是唯一的,确保了交易的安全性和准确性。 ### 2. 比特币钱包地址的结构 比特币钱包地址通常是由一组字母和数字组成,长度通常在26到35个字符之间。不同类型的比特币地址,结构上也有所不同。例如,常见的比特币地址以“1”、“3”或“bc1”开头。 ## 三、比特币钱包地址的种类 比特币钱包地址主要有以下几种类型: ### 1. **传统地址(Legacy Address)** 传统地址是指以“1”开头的比特币地址。这种地址是比特币早期版本所采用的格式,也是最为广泛使用的一种地址类型。虽然它们在安全性和效率上相对较低,但仍然受到许多用户的喜爱。 ### 2. **兼容地址(P2SH Address)** 兼容地址以“3”开头,代表“Pay-to-Script-Hash”。这种地址的创建是为了支持更复杂的交易,例如多签名或时间锁定交易。大多数现代钱包都能生成这种地址,并提供更强的安全性。 ### 3. **隔离见证地址(SegWit Address)** 隔离见证(Segregated Witness)是一种提高比特币交易效率与横向扩展能力的技术。隔离见证地址通常以“bc1”开头,属于比特币改进提议(BIP)的第141号提案。此类型的地址具备更低的交易费用和更快的确认时间。 ### 4. **比特币现金地址** 比特币现金(Bitcoin Cash)是一种硬分叉出来的版本,其钱包地址的结构及格式与比特币有所不同。尽管它们都涉及比特币的底层技术,但会有不同的使用场景和社区支持。 ## 四、比特币钱包地址的生成机制 比特币钱包地址的生成过程涉及复杂的加密技术。首先,用户需要生成一对公钥和私钥。公钥用于生成地址,而私钥则用于签署交易,保证交易的安全性。 ### 1. **密钥对的生成** 用户通常通过钱包软件生成密钥对,其中公钥是将私钥经过椭圆曲线算法计算得出的。用户需要妥善保管私钥,因为只要拥有私钥,就能够控制与之关联的比特币。 ### 2. **地址的生成过程** 公钥经过哈希算法(SHA-256和RIPEMD-160)后,会生成比特币地址的哈希值。为确保地址的安全性和完整性,最终生成的地址会附加一个校验码。用户根据这些步骤生成属于自己的比特币钱包地址。 ## 五、比特币钱包地址的管理与保护 ### 1. **安全性的重要性** 由于比特币是一种高度匿名和去中心化的数字资产,确保钱包地址的安全性至关重要。用户需要采取措施保护他们的私钥,以免被黑客窃取。例如,可以使用硬件钱包或冷存储技术来增强安全性。 ### 2. **地址的分类与总结** 用户不应仅依靠单一的钱包地址接收比特币,尤其是在进行大额交易时。合理分配多个地址可以有效分散风险,提高资产的安全性。同时,用户在进行交易时,建议使用新地址来增强隐私。 ### 3. **便于管理的工具** 市面上有多款比特币钱包软件,支持多种地址格式,如Electrum、Exodus等。用户可以根据自身需求选择合适的钱包,并定期检查地址的使用情况及余额,以提高对资产的管理能力。 ## 六、常见问题解答 ### 1. **如何选择适合的比特币钱包?** 选择一个适合自己的比特币钱包需要考虑多个因素,包括安全性、功能、易用性等。用户应该根据自身资产规模和交易频率做出合理选择。 隐私和安全是选择钱包时必须重点关注的方面。硬件钱包如Ledger和Trezor被许多人认为是安全性最高的选择;而对于日常交易,可能更倾向于使用移动钱包或桌面钱包。同时,用户也应定期备份钱包数据,以避免意外数据丢失。 ### 2. **如何生成比特币钱包地址?** 生成比特币钱包地址,首先需要下载一个可靠的比特币钱包软件。安装后,根据向导生成你的密钥对,再通过软件自动完成地址的生成工作。用户可以轻松快捷地完成这一流程。 ### 3. **比特币地址可以被多次使用吗?** 可以,但并不建议。每个比特币地址理论上是可以重复使用的,但是出于隐私保护和安全的考虑,建议在每次交易中使用新的地址。这种做法可以有效提高资产的隐蔽性,保护用户的隐私。 ### 4. **比特币地址是否易受攻击?** 比特币地址本身并不是易受攻击的对象,但其相关的私钥一旦被窃取,攻击者即可控制该地址的所有资金。为了防止黑客攻击,使用强密码、启用两步验证等措施,会显著提高安全性。 ### 5. **如何进行比特币交易?** 进行比特币交易的步骤相对简单。用户需打开自己的钱包软件,输入接收方的比特币地址和相关金额进行交易。系统会自动处理交易并更新账本,一旦交易被确认,所转账的比特币就会到账。 ## 七、总结 比特币钱包地址的种类及其生成机制是理解比特币生态系统不可或缺的一部分。通过对地址的全面了解,用户不仅可以有效地进行比特币的管理与交易,还能够在一定程度上提升资产的安全性。在这个日新月异的加密货币市场中,把握钱包地址的变化,是每个投资者与爱好者都需要关注的重要话题。